NoticeWare E-mail Server 5.1.2.2 Pre-Auth DoS Exploit

NoticeWare E-mail Server has many odd querks about it. This DoS leverages the fact that the POP3 server can only handle so many exceptions before you get an access violation at 0x00000008 which is given from an EDX+8 where EDX is 0x00000000. I've tried many things to get code execution and non are prevalent. If you fuzz almost any of the commands for the POP3 server you will get it to crash. Also, if you are authenticated and do 'LIST 0.5' (numerous times) you will get the same access violation you do with this DoS.

Mitigation:

Update to the latest version of NoticeWare E-mail Server
